cadence原理图怎么生产padspcb
时间: 2025-04-08 16:25:22 浏览: 55
<think>好的,我现在需要帮助用户了解如何在Cadence Allegro中生成PADS格式的PCB文件。用户提到参考的引用内容,我需要仔细查看这些引用,确保步骤正确。
首先,引用[1]和[2]提到需要先将Allegro的.brd文件转换为Altium Designer的.pcbdoc文件,然后再转到PADS。这可能涉及到中间转换工具。而引用[3]提到了网表导入的方法,但用户的问题是关于PCB文件的转换,所以可能网表部分不是重点,但需要确认是否有其他步骤关联。
接下来,我应该整理步骤。根据引用[2],第一步是使用Allegro的Export功能导出为Allegro PCB Designer格式。然后使用Altium Designer导入,再导出为PADS的ASCII文件。不过用户最终需要的是PADS的.pcb文件,所以可能需要用PADS软件导入ASCII文件并保存。
另外,引用[1]提到Allegro转PADS的方法,但具体步骤可能涉及第三方工具,比如可能需要使用Skill脚本或转换工具。但根据引用中的信息,转换过程可能需要通过Altium作为中介。需要确认是否还有其他方法,比如直接导出,但根据现有引用,可能必须经过Altium这一步。
同时,需要注意文件格式的正确转换,例如alg后缀转为pcbdoc,再转为asc,然后PADS导入asc生成.pcb文件。用户可能需要安装Altium Designer和PADS软件,或者是否有其他替代工具,但引用中没有提到,所以可能需要按现有步骤说明。
还需要检查是否有版本差异,例如Allegro 16.6和PADS 9.5可能存在兼容性问题,可能需要特定的导出设置。例如在Altium导出时选择正确的ASCII格式,或者在PADS导入时处理报告文件中的错误,如引用[3]提到的复制report.rep的内容到asc文件中。
总结步骤应为:Allegro导出为alg文件 -> Altium导入并导出为ASCII -> PADS导入ASCII生成PCB。过程中需要注意中间文件的正确转换,以及可能的错误处理,如替换文件头或处理不兼容元素。此外,用户可能需要安装必要的转换工具或插件,如Allegro的Export功能可能需要特定设置。
最后,生成相关问题时要围绕转换步骤、工具使用、常见错误处理等方面,帮助用户深入理解可能遇到的问题。</think>在Cadence Allegro中将PCB文件转换为PADS格式需要借助中间工具完成,以下是具体步骤:
### 转换步骤
1. **从Allegro导出中间格式文件**
- 在Allegro中打开.brd文件,通过菜单栏选择 **File > Export > IDF**,将文件保存为Allegro PCB Designer格式(.alg文件)[^2]。
2. **使用Altium Designer转换文件**
- 在Altium Designer中导入.alg文件:选择 **File > Import Wizard**,按指引完成导入。
- 导出为PADS兼容的ASCII格式:选择 **File > Save As**,保存类型为 **PADS ASCII (*.asc)**[^2]。
3. **在PADS中生成最终PCB文件**
- 打开PADS软件,新建PCB项目。
- 选择 **File > Import**,加载上一步生成的.asc文件。
- 根据提示处理可能的错误(如封装不匹配),保存为PADS的.pcb格式[^3]。
```plaintext
文件转换流程:
Allegro (.brd) → Altium (.pcbdoc) → PADS ASCII (.asc) → PADS (.pcb)
```
### 注意事项
- 转换过程中需检查元件封装和网络表的兼容性,部分特殊元素可能需要手动调整。
- 若遇到ASCII文件导入错误,需用文本编辑器修改.asc文件头,替换为PADS识别的版本标识。
阅读全文
相关推荐


















